How Technology Makes No Verification Casinos Possible

The backbone of no verification casinos lies in innovative technology. Payment methods like Trustly and BankID are crucial here, enabling instant deposits and withdrawals without demanding excessive personal data. These tools authenticate transactions securely, allowing casinos to trust users without manual ID checks.

Moreover, blockchain and cryptocurrency have played a role in this evolution. Bitcoin and other crypto payments offer enhanced anonymity, making it easier for operators to bypass traditional verification. Naturally, this raises questions about security and fairness, but many platforms employ SSL encryption and licensed software from providers like NetEnt and Pragmatic Play to maintain trust.

The Role of Responsible Gaming in a No Verification Environment

Another aspect worth considering is responsible gambling. No verification casinos might encourage impulsive behavior simply because the barrier to entry is so low. Without the usual documentation steps, players can dive in more spontaneously, which can be a double-edged sword.

Many platforms now incorporate tools like de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and reality checks to promote healthier gambling patterns. Still, self-awareness remains key. Recognizing when a game stops being fun is crucial, particularly in environments that emphasize speed and anonymity.
